          • Sunroof and water leaks

            In the quest to find my water leak I have:
            Pulled out the rear seats, the boot trim and discovered a little water in the corners of the boot are ( the ones under the tail lights).
            The passenger side sunroof drain pipe wasn't even connected
            Thought I'd have a rest before I remove the head liner
